How often do you drop your phone?

According to a new study, your age may determine the frequency.

A new poll of 2,000 U.S. adults, divided evenly among Generation Z (ages 18–26), millennials (27–42), Generation X (43–58), and baby boomers (59–77), found Gen Z to be the clumsiest generation, averaging 187 “close call” phone drops annually. 

In fact, 79% of Gen Zers surveyed said their current phone was damaged due to a drop, including a cracked screen or damaged battery.

For reference, the average person - from all those surveyed, dropped their phone 140 times in a year.
